Now Hiring at Kaman Auctions! We are a family owned & operated automobile auction looking to hire a full-time lot attendant to assist in stocking vehicle inventory and organizing weekly lot operations. We are located in Edmonds, Washington. Searching for someone willing to grow with the company and bring their skills to help further Kaman’s success. Schedule Monday - Friday Day shift Hours 9AM – 5PM Starting Wage $16.00 D.O.E. Benefits Medical & Dental Insurance (Regence) Simple IRA w/ Employer Match Preferred Skills & Brief Job Description • Automotive Knowledge • Technically inclined • Multitasking • Customer Service Applicant must be willing and able to perform job functions in all types of weather conditions. Light mechanical work such as checking fluid levels & jump-starting vehicles is required. Must be a team player. Facilitate the movement of vehicles around lot as needed. Assist with getting vehicles running, organized, and stocked into inventory prior to auction. Previous mechanical experience preferred. Should be self-motivated, organized, and disciplined. Computer proficient. Essential Duties & Responsibilities • Responsible for moving vehicles either on the lot or to and from other facilities. • Proactively position vehicles and stock inventory into preferred locations. • Responsible for observing safety policies. • Contributes to and encourages others to demonstrate a team focused, values-based service culture throughout the company. • Contributes to effective operations by providing support where and when it is needed. • Responsible for always maintaining confidentiality. • Other duties as requested or assigned to maintain efficient operations and optimum service levels. Physical Demands • Requires the ability to operate automatic as well as manual transmission vehicles. • Requires the ability to read, communicate, and interpret information accurately in English. • Requires the ability to remain calm under high-pressure situations. • Must be able to drive and work in adverse weather conditions • Requires the ability to get into and out of vehicles with relative ease. • While performing the duties of this job the employee is frequently required to stand for long periods of time Work Environment • Work is performed in extreme outdoor weather conditions • Work is performed primarily outdoors and inside customer vehicles. • There are frequent employee and/or customer contacts throughout the workday. Education and/or Experience Requirements • Must be able to drive both standard and automatic transmission vehicles. • Must have a clean driving record as demonstrated by minimal moving violations. • Must be 18 years of age and possess a valid driver's license and be able to pass a background check. Language Skills Must demonstrate the ability to interact tactfully and positively with customers, employees, and management. Reasoning Abilities Must demonstrate the ability to use common sense and good judgment when dealing with problematic situations.
